Quarterly Planning Note — Heads of Department

Following careful review of forecast demand, the executive committee has approved a hiring freeze within the Calder Instruments division, effective the first of next quarter. Existing offers will be honoured; backfills require sign-off from the planning office. Other divisions are unaffected, though heads should expect closer scrutiny of requisitions. Please brief your teams factually and avoid speculation. The rationale is recorded in the confidential note below.

board note of bajop-yaweg: The western region missed its Pelys quota by 58.0 percent last quarter. Pelysek Foods plans to raise the Belius list price by 44.0 percent in July. The steering committee signed off on a budget of $133.8 million for Project Pelax. The renewal with Zoraelix Systems closes at $61.9 million a year, 12.7 percent above the last contract.

Handover: waveform preview in Soundline's clip editor. I moved peak extraction from the render thread to a worker, so scrubbing no longer stutters on files over ten minutes. Downsampling uses min/max pairs per bucket; the old RMS path is still behind a flag until Priya confirms design sign-off. Known gap: mono files render slightly taller because normalization ignores channel count — fix is staged but unreviewed. Cache invalidation keys off the asset hash, not the filename. Full notes on the internal page.

operations page: https://vault.qirvanhq.local/ticket

## 2.8.0 — Cron migration key rotation

All nightly cron jobs have been moved from the legacy scheduler to the Orvane workflow engine. As part of this migration, the old job-signing credential was retired and replaced. Workflows now refuse bundles signed with the prior credential. For the release manager: update the signing step in the pipeline config to use the key below.

deploy key for kajof-fajop: bky6_gDHw9Q

First, drain any in-flight rotation jobs and confirm the audit log shows no pending grants. Then update the rotation schedule: v3 enforces a minimum interval and will refuse overlapping windows, so stale cron-style entries must be removed rather than commented out. Note that v3 validates its config strictly at boot and aborts on unknown keys. After migration, the utility should be running with the following configuration values.

settings of tagef-bawif:
DRUIX_HOST=druix.zemvarlabs.internal
DRUIX_PORT=8000